- If you don't have the altitude of a triangle you can find the area of the triangle using Heron's formula. Heron's formula is a mathematical formula that gives the area of a triangle when the lengths of its three sides are known. The formula is:
A = sqrt(s(s-a)(s-b)(s-c))
